I thought I would share my knife storage project. I go to a lot of gun shows and flea markets in search of knives, and other treasures. I am always looking for a good way to safely carry knives that I might sell or trade, and of course a way to store the ones I buy. I also need a good way to store knives at home. So when I saw this DeWalt drill case laying around, I started to think about its potential as a knife case. The plans / design changed many times. Here is the finished project, scroll down to see how it came to be.



It stared as a regular DeWalt Drill case. (no drills were harmed in the making of this project..............)



The first task was to cut out all the plastic dividers from the inside. That was not fun. Fortunately, no blood loss occurred during this phase!!



I changed the design over and over and eventually settled on this. Wood divider on one side for miscellaneous knives and boxes, fixed blade storage on the other.



Needed a soft interior so I lined it all with felt. I used that stretch cord to allow easy in and out of the larger fixed blades. It is hard to see in the pictures, but there are holes at the ends so I can carry it by the handle, or sling it over my shoulder with a strap.
